Gov Alia conspiring with PDP to destroy APC in Benue – Lawmakers

Governor Hyacinth Alia

The National Assembly caucus from Benue State, under the platform of the ruling All Progressives Congress, APC, say governor Hyacinth Alia, has been working against the party’s interest since he came to office.

They disclosed that the governor colluded with leading figures in the Peoples Democratic Party, PDP, to undermine the APC, especially during election of principal officers in the State House of Assembly.

The aggrieved federal lawmakers made the disclosure at a press briefing in Abuja on Thursday.

“The election of the speaker of Benue House of Assembly: The position of the speaker was zoned to the Jembagh bloc of Benue North West Senatorial District, coincidentally the birthplace of the SGF, Sen. Dr. George Akume, whereas APC has 22 members out of a total of 32 members of the Assembly.

“Governor Alia connived with former Governor Gabriel Suswam of PDP to produce a speaker different from the candidate preferred by APC. In the contest for the position of the Speaker, Governor Alia held midnight meetings at the residence of Sen. Gabriel Suswam and got ten (10) PDP members to align with 7 recalcitrant APC members to beat the APC preferred candidate by the margin of 2 votes, thus began his unholy alliance with PDP to undermine and maltreat the legitimate members of APC in Benue State.

“After the Speakership debacle, the party again nominated and made a spread of principal officers of the assembly, comprising- Majority Leader, Deputy Majority Leader, Chief Whip and Deputy Chief Whip. Surprisingly, the speaker joyfully agreed with the opposition party on all nominations from the Peoples Democratic Party as endorsed by the State Chairman of the PDP and Secretary but jettisoned the list submitted by APC and rather accepted the list that was unilaterally submitted by the Governor through his Chief of Staff.

“It was an embarrassing experience for the Party having to face the dejection in the hands of an administration it laboured hard to install”

The member representing Ado/Okpokwu/Ogbadibo Federal Constituency, Hon. Philip Agbese has also accused the Governor of nepotism, saying he appointed over 30 key political officers from his immediate clan in Vandeikya LGA, whereas, the Idoma speaking people from Benue South were grossly shortchanged in the scheme of things.
